Title :
Fused bitapered single-mode fiber directional coupler for core and cladding mode coupling

Abstract :
We demonstrate a new functional fiber component providing coupling between the LP1m cladding (LP1mcl) mode in one single-mode fiber (SMF) and the LP01 core mode in another SMF. The phase-matching condition in the coupling region is achieved by prepulling the fiber sections. The experimentally demonstrated coupling efficiency between the LP01 core and the LP13cl modes is more than 60% over 70-nm wavelength range with less than 3% variation over 90°C temperature range.
